RIP to artist Lois Curtis. She had an intellectual disability and diagnosed with mental illness. She was the plaintiff in the Olmstead vs L.C. that led to a Supreme Court decision benefitting the elderly and disabled to move out of institutional care and into their own home.

HBO Max has a reality show called “Homegrown,” where Atlanta farmer Jamila Norman helps families who want to transform their backyards into fruit & veggie gardens do so.
